## Build Provenance: Image Slimming (Carthollow Pipeline)

All service images are now built from the slimmed Carthollow base. The slimming step strips shells, package managers, and debug tools after dependency resolution, reducing attack surface and image size by roughly 70%. Each slimmed image carries an attestation linking it to its unslimmed parent and the exact slimming ruleset used. The attested build is identified by the token below.

session token of fahap-hawip = htk31_7852f2b3276dba2738f98fa97f92237

## 3.9.2 — Key rotation

Rotated the signing key for the Glimmerpane snapshot-testing pipeline after the quarterly audit. Old key revoked as of this release; snapshot baselines re-signed. If the UI snapshot job fails verification overnight, purge the runner's trust cache and retry. No component changes in this release. The new deploy key is the following.

signing key of bagap-yawep = bky13_TbfT6ZMUoGJo2

**Q: The ContrastGuard audit job failed and locked the audit service account. What now?**

A: This happens when the Huebright crawler exceeds its scan quota mid-run. Kill the stuck job, reset the quota counter in the admin panel, and restart only the failed page batch — not the full site sweep. The service account unlock prompt accepts a recovery passphrase, not the normal credential. Use the one recorded below.

unlock words, hahip-baduf: holwyn-istath-julvan

## Authentication

Heads up: the nightly reindex job (`reindex_nightly.py`) talks to the Lanternfish search cluster, and that cluster won't accept anonymous writes anymore — we locked it down last sprint. The job now authenticates as the `reindex-runner` service identity against Corvid Gateway, and the token is injected via the `LF_INDEX_TOKEN` env var in the scheduler config. Nothing clever going on, just a bearer header on every batch request. For review purposes, the staging credential currently in use is listed below.

service key, kadug-kadup: kto15_rN23XLAYImmZgrJ